Digvir Jayas, biosystems engineering, along with co-investigators
from the Grain Research Laboratory of the Canadian Grain Commission and
the Cereal Research Centre of Agriculture and Agri-Food Canada, received a
three-year NSERC award of $351,189 for their work on a machine vision
system to automate operations at grain handling facilities. Industry
partners include VisionSmart Inc., the Canadian Grain Commission’s
Industry Services Division and Grain Research Laboratory, and the Cereal
Research Centre.
